S.Res. 103

A resolution designating March 29, 2017, as "Vietnam Veterans Day".

Designates March 29, 2017, as Vietnam Veterans Day.

Recognizes the contributions of veterans who served in Vietnam or in support of operations in Vietnam during war and peace.

Submitted in the Senate, considered, and agreed to without amendment and with a preamble by Unanimous Consent. (consideration: CR S2115; text as passed Senate: CR S2103-2104)
